Olivia Rodrigo scores yet another chart success with her sophomore album GUTS

 


   Olivia Rodrigo's September-8 released second studio album, GUTS, opens atop the UK Official Albums Chart, marking the American singer's second number-one album on the run, following her debut SOUR set which returns to the top-ten of the UK chart (week of 15 September 2023 - 21 September 2023). Released via Geffen Records, the album has already spawned the singer's third number one on the UK Official Singles Chart with "vampire" (2023) following “drivers license” and “good 4 u,” which both summited in 2021. The album was produced by Dan Nigro and has thus opened atop the album charts in  Australia, Netherlands, Germany, Ireland, New Zealand, Norway, Scotland and Sweden turning it into a commercial success.

On the UK Singles front, Olivia adds another top-ten entry with "get him back" (No.7 debut) scoring her 7th UK top-ten on the list following "bad idea right".  On the ARIA Singles Chart for the week of 18 September 2023, Rodrigo's "vampire" is just behind Doja Cat's "Paint the Town Red", in the runner up spot, while debuting two new entries therein with "get him back" at #6 and "all american bitch" at #10, also considering "bad idea right" sitting at its No.3 peak. As noted earlier, the album opened atop the ARIA Albums Chart marking the singer's second number-one album entry in the land Down Under.

   The album debuted at No.1 on the US Billboard 200 list (dated Sept. 23), with 302,000 equivalent album units, marking Rodrigo's second number-one entry on the record chart, following 2021's SOUR (her debut set, having entered at #1 with 295,000 ablum-equivalent units). The album's lead single "vampire" opened atop the equivalent Billboard Hot 100 list (dated July 15), earning the singer her third #1 entry therein (following "driver's license" and "good 4 u" in 2021). The next single "bad idea right?" proved to be another top-ten success on the chart. SOUR was released May 21, 2021, one of the best-selling albums of that year, opening atop major charts around the globe including the US and the UK, while spawning four US Hot 100 top-ten singles while earning the singer three Grammy wins for Best Pop Vocal AlbumPop Solo Performance (for driver's license) and Best New Artist at the 64th Annual Grammy Awards (2022). Billboard ranked it the second best album of the year 2021 just below Morgan Wallen's Dangerous: The Double Album, while it ranked the biggest seller of the same year in Australia. 

"vampire" returned to number one on the Billboard Hot 100 (dated Sept. 9), following a nine week stay below the top spot, the same week her sophomore record set in atop the Billboard 200 chart. Also, "bad idea right?" rose to a new No.7 high, and all the 12 tracks from the album appear on the Hot 100 as follows: "get him back" (11), "All-American Bitch" (13), "Lacy" (23), "Ballad of a Homeschooled Girl" (24), "Making the Bed" (19), "Logical" (20), "Love Is Embarrassing" (25), "The Grudge" (16), "Pretty Isn't Pretty" (30), and "Teenage Dream" (39).
